Introduction

Mt. Gox, once the largest Bitcoin exchange, collapsed in 2014, leading to significant losses for investors. The exchange is currently undergoing civil rehabilitation, with recent reports indicating a potential transfer of a substantial amount of Bitcoin.

Mt. Gox Transfer

Details and Speculation

Reports indicate that Mt. Gox plans to transfer approximately 32,371 BTC on July 24. This amount is roughly 10% of its total holdings and is valued at about 330 billion yen. The purpose of this transfer is under speculation, with theories ranging from creditor repayment to raising funds for new investments.

Implications for Creditors

If the transfer is aimed at repaying creditors, it could mark a significant step towards resolving the financial issues stemming from Mt. Gox’s collapse. Creditors who suffered losses in 2014 have been waiting for restitution, and this transfer might signal progress in the ongoing civil rehabilitation process.

Historical Context

The Collapse of Mt. Gox

Mt. Gox was the largest Bitcoin exchange until its infamous collapse in 2014, when approximately 850,000 BTC were lost due to a hack. This event had a profound impact on the cryptocurrency market, leading to increased regulatory scrutiny and the implementation of more robust security measures across the industry.

Recovery Efforts

Since the collapse, efforts have been ongoing to recover and return the lost Bitcoins to affected creditors. The process has been slow and complex, involving numerous legal and regulatory challenges. The potential transfer of Bitcoin marks a significant milestone in these recovery efforts.
